» Bishop’s Cleeve Foodbank. The foodbank in Bishop’s Cleeve has seen a big rise in demand last week, following the closure of local schools.
Grateful thanks to those remaining local volunteers who have provided extra cover to run this service as more than half of the existing volunteers are now self-isolating following the latest guidelines.
Besides local volunteers, there are also volunteers working at Guiting Power Central warehouse doing extra shifts processing donations and preparing food parcels.
Please can you take any donations to the only open local collection point, currently at Bishop’s Cleeve Parish Office (next to Tesco’s car park), any Friday morning between 9am and noon. Thank you for your generosity supporting local people who don’t have the money and are really struggling to feed their families at this time.
Please refer to the latest shopping list for further details of shortages on the ‘donating food’ link at northcotswold.foodbank.org.uk and for details on making direct monetary donations.

» The Cobalt Cancer Service is making its mobile CT scanners available to NHS England to support patients with the coronavirus, cancer and other urgent health conditions across the country where they are needed.
The mobile CT scanners will be staffed by the service’s radiographers and may support the new field hospitals.
The imaging centres in Cheltenham and Birmingham will provide urgent scans for cancer patients to enable them to continue with their treatment.

» The Deerhurst Flower Festival was due to take place over the August Bank Holiday weekend – from Saturday to Monday, August 29 to 31.
Due to the Covid-19 pandemic it has been decided to postpone the festival.
We hope it will now take place over the August Bank Holiday weekend next year instead, but look for confirmation of this in this column and on the Flower Festival website deerhurstflower festival.com
